Ingredients
-
1 lb ground beef or ground turkey
-
1 tbsp olive oil
-
1 small onion (diced)
-
2 cloves garlic (minced)
-
3 medium potatoes (diced into small cubes)
-
1 tsp salt
-
½ tsp black pepper
-
½ tsp smoked paprika
-
½ tsp garlic powder
-
½ tsp onion powder
-
1 cup beef or chicken broth
-
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
-
½ cup shredded mozzarella cheese
-
2 tbsp chopped parsley (for garnish)
Instructions
-
Cook the Meat:
-
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
-
Add diced onion and cook for 2 minutes until softened.
-
Add ground beef, breaking it apart with a spoon, and cook until browned. Drain excess grease if needed.
-
-
Cook the Potatoes:
-
Stir in minced garlic, potatoes, salt, pepper, pa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der.
-
Pour in broth, cover, and let simmer for 10-12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until potatoes are tender.
-
-
Melt the Cheese:
-
Once potatoes are cooked, sprinkle shredded cheddar and mozzarella cheese on top.
-
Cover with a lid and let the cheese melt for 2-3 minutes.
-
-
Serve:
-
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ot.
